Owing to recent developments in tritium chemistry and analysis, high-quality tritium-labelled drugs can now be prepared simply, cheaply and in timescales commensurate with those needed for rapid drug discovery in adsorption, distribution, metabolism and excretion (ADME) projects. Such 3H-labelled drugs are enabling high-quality decision-making at key points in the drug discovery process, thus ensuring more effective research projects, a key issue in commercial success. In addition, tritium-labelled compounds continue to play a significant role in ADME studies later in the pharmaceutical development process. This is especially so for highly potent and hence low-dose agents, for drugs with complex structures and for those compounds that undergo molecular fragmentation as a result of metabolism.
